What can I expect during my initial assessment?
During your initial assessment, your physiotherapist will begin by discussing your medical history and current concerns to gain a clear understanding of your condition. This will be followed by a comprehensive physical examination to accurately diagnose the issue and identify the potential causes.

Based on the assessment, your therapist will explain the likely reasons behind your injury or condition, as well as what to expect from physiotherapy. You will receive immediate treatment as needed, along with personalized exercises to perform at home to support your recovery.

Additionally, your therapist will provide an estimate of how long it may take for your condition to improve and outline the number of sessions required to achieve full recovery within a realistic time frame.

Are your physiotherapists experienced, registered, and insured?
Yes, all our physiotherapists have extensive clinical experience in both the NHS and private sectors. They are registered with the Health & Care Professions Council (HCPC) and the Chartered Society of Physiotherapy (CSP), ensuring they meet the highest professional standards. You can verify their registration through the HCPC register and learn more about CSP membership here.

In addition, all our therapists are fully insured, DBS checked (Enhanced Disclosure and Barring), and complete mandatory training, including infection control, manual handling, and fire safety, so you can feel confident and safe when receiving care in your home.
